Hi raz0r, I just noticed your thread and I'm replying based on my research and experince over the last year.

I was invited to NATRAX where I got to test drive the E63S, and was able to drive the M5C on Bangalore's "amazing" roads.

Here is my conclusion,
E63S - Better(softer) suspension, the fit and finish within the cabin is better, and a better sounding exhaust(hands down). The dials on the wheels look really cool/sporty. In general the inside of the E63S is better than M5C and steering felt nicer on this comapred to the M5C.

M5C - Bigger engine(4.2l) which results in a negligble increase in performance, better seats and wireless apple/android car play. Stiffer suspension that is suited for a race track that turns into a liability on our Bangalore roads.

I wanted one of these because this will be the last of the V8s ever produced. Going forward it'll be hybrid and then completely electric. So pick one up while you can.

Having lived with an AMG with low ground clearence I knew that I did not want to repeat the same mistake again, so point for E63s.
In sheer performance the M5C is definitely better, due to its stiffer suspernsion/handling around curves and more power, but lets be honest here, neither of us are going to truly exercise the full power of either of these cars on our roads and we arent going to be taking them to any track, so the advantage the M5C poses can never be experienced, but the softer/higher suspension on the E63S will make it a lot more useful on our roads and you will find the courage to take it out to more places without worrying. Even the
minor power advantage the M5C gives is something you will not notice in comparison to the E63S.

But finally, it boils down to you what you really want. The owner of the M5C that I met didn't care about the differences and he just wanted the most powerful and sporty V8, plus he seemed like a BMW fanboy. So, you decide, are looking for usability or are you going only for the sporty appeal.

I'm expecting my E63S by June.

P.S: the M5C has to be spec'd by you as they dont give many features that come by default on the E63S
